Before diving into the functionality of asphalt mix calculators, it is essential to understand the basic components of asphalt. The mix design process involves determining the optimal proportions of these components to achieve desired performance criteria, such as strength, durability, and resistance to weather conditions. Asphalt pavement typically consists of aggregates (stone, sand, and gravel), asphalt binder (a petroleum product), and sometimes additives to enhance performance.
